#3f2506 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3f2506 is composed of 24.7% red, 14.5%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.3% magenta, 90.5% yellow and 75.3% black. It has a hue angle of 32.6 degrees, a saturation of 82.6% and a lightness of 13.5%. #3f2506 color hex could be obtained by blending #7e4a0c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#3f2506
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090501 is the darkest color, while #fefbf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3f2506
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#242321 is the less saturated color, while #442501 is the most saturated one.
